The proving ground

It has to work on our floor first.

Roman Foods is not a case study. It is where Beacon lives, and where every workflow earns its way into the product.

Beacon runs the food safety program at Roman Foods today. The CCP checks, the sanitation schedule, the corrective actions, the document approvals: not a demo tenant, the live program at an SQF-certified manufacturing facility in Michigan, with our founder responsible for it.

That changes how the software gets built. When a workflow is clumsy, our own team hits the clumsiness first, on a real line, with real product moving. When an auditor walks that plant, Beacon is the program they see. The stakes are ours before they are yours.
